浏览量: 273 次浏览

python介绍与安装

2019年10月3日 0 作者 Nie Hen

由来发展
优缺点
安装

由来发展


python是一种广泛使用的解释型、高级编程、通用型编程语言,由吉多·范罗苏姆创造,第一版发布于1991年。
enter description here
(1989年的圣诞节期间,吉多·范罗苏姆为了在阿姆斯特丹打发时间,决心开发一个新的脚本解释程序。之所以选中Python作为程序的名字,是因为他是BBC电视剧——蒙提·派森的飞行马戏团的爱好者。)

优缺点


优点
1. 强大的库: Python就为我们提供了非常完善的基础代码库,覆盖了网络、文件、GUI、数据库、文本等大量内容,被形象地称作“内置电池(batteries included)”。用Python开发,许多功能不必从零编写,直接使用现成的即可。还有数量庞大的第三方库。
2. 胶水语言: 它能够轻易地操作其他程序,轻易地包装使用其他语言编写的库
3. 简单易学:语法简单,容易上手。虽然底层是用c写的,但是摒弃了指针,复杂的语法。
4. 易读、规范:按照缩进来控制代码块,代码写出来整齐规范,而且易读。(c java那些大括号,如果写的不规范,就算是自己写的看的也头疼 )
等等
缺点
跳转到的位置
1. 运行速度:python的运行速度一直都是个诟病,相比较其他几种高级语言速度相对慢。
2. 开源性:由于python是解释性语言,一行一行运行,不会编译生成机器码。所以给别人用就得给源码(除非打包)
3. 多线程:python的多线程是一个‘假的’多线程,不是很好用。

安装


python是跨平台的,Windows,linux(自带python),mac都可以安装。
有两个大版本2.x 和3.x 。
两个大版本是不兼容的,语法都有些差别。
2.x在逐步被放弃被3.x替代,有些老资料里面还是用的2.x 以2.7居多。
3.x版本是目前用的较多的,最新是3.8版本,3.5 3.6这三个版本用的很多。3.x版本之间语法基本没有差别,但是有些库需要特定的python版本。

Windows安装
python3.7下载链接
安装的时候要将 环境变量添加进去那个选项填上去,不然安装好之后还要手动配置环境变量。
enter description here
安装好之后 打开命令行窗口输入python
enter description here
显示python版本 说明安装成功

如果没有显示,则说明没有添加到环境变量里面。
要把安装的python.exe 的路径添加到环境变量里面。
enter description here
enter description here

linux安装
在linux命令行中 输入

sudo apt-get install python3

安装成功后输入python 回车
显示python版本 则说明安装正确
enter description here

mac安装
买不起mac 😭 没有测试过